The “LF” stamping refers to “long flat,” which signifies a Canadian. There is also an LLF. When I get one, I’ll let you know. Although the nomenclature is a little buffed down and is no longer crisp, every letter is legible. Nothing has been buffed out. The “Barling’s Make,” is in block letters and is arched, putting this squarely into the family era of Barling pipe making. For a full, almost exhausting explanation, please read the Barling page on Pipedia, a true gem of a resource. The crossed “Barling” logo is also in pretty good shape, if far from perfect. The blast is still good, but some of its sharpness has been diminished by handling. Well, isn’t that how an old, great smoking pipe is supposed to be? It is also stamped TVF and the size is a Grp. 6. Used.
6 1/8” long, bowl 1.9” tall. Weight: 1.5 oz., 41 grams.
